Tibetan Buddhism is a branch of the Mahayana school; the Dalai Lama is the spiritual leader of the Gelug, or Yellow Hat, branch of Tibetan Buddhism, which stresses ethics and monastic discipline. After the downfall of China's Qing Dynasty in 1911, Tibet enjoyed de facto independence (but not international diplomatic recognition) for nearly four decades, until China's Communist revolution of 1949. The preparations appear to be a Chinese attemp tto avoid repeating the chaotic events of 1995, when, without consulting the Chinese government, the Dalai Lama declared that a six-year-old boy, Gedhun Choekyi Nyima, was the next reincarnated Panchen Lama, the second most important figure in Tibetan Buddhism. For the Tibetan leadership, the issue is not seen as pressing; aside from a brief cancer scare, the Dalai Lama is reported to be in good health and has himself said he will begin making a decision about his reincarnation options after he turns 90. Since 1959, the Dalai Lama has lived in exile in Dharamshala, nestled in the Himalayas, and Tibet has remained a sensitive factor in India's relationship with China, with whom it shares a 2, 000-mile border.
